In 1833, Murdoch McLeod entered the world in Inverness, Scotland, born to Donald Mcleod And Marion Sarah Mckenzie. Murdoch McLeod married Julia Gillies, and had children including Alexander Mcleod, Catherine Katie Mcleod, Christina Mcleod, Euphemia Phemie Mcleod, Flora Mcleod, Hector Mcleod, Julia Mcleod, Mary Mcleod. Murdoch McLeod passed away in 1878 in Clunes Cemetery, Victoria, Australia.
